Forensic Pathology: A Journey into Mortality

Forensic pathology unveils the mysteries surrounding death, bridging the gap between medicine and criminal justice. These specialized physicians, often referred to as medical examiners or coroners, meticulously scrutinize cadavers to determine the cause, manner, and mechanism of passing. Their investigations delve into a grim reality, unraveling the intricate accounts etched onto every tissue and organ. From blunt force trauma to poisoning, from accidental incidents to deliberate acts, forensic pathologists piece together the puzzle of mortality with unwavering precision.

  • Leveraging their in-depth knowledge of human anatomy and pathology, these investigators conduct meticulous autopsies to gather crucial evidence.
  • They meticulously document every finding, generating detailed reports that inform legal proceedings and aim to bring closure to grieving families.
